Whamcloud - gitweb
Branch: b1_4
authoradilger <adilger>
Mon, 7 Mar 2005 18:50:42 +0000 (18:50 +0000)
committeradilger <adilger>
Mon, 7 Mar 2005 18:50:42 +0000 (18:50 +0000)
Print ll_dir_readpage offset, use 64-bit value for calculation.

lustre/llite/dir.c

index 4499f5f..1fba7a7 100644 (file)
@@ -66,12 +66,12 @@ static int ll_dir_readpage(struct file *file, struct page *page)
         int rc = 0;
         ENTRY;
 
-        CDEBUG(D_VFSTRACE, "VFS Op:inode=%lu/%u(%p)\n", inode->i_ino,
-               inode->i_generation, inode);
+        offset = (__u64)page->index << PAGE_SHIFT;
+        CDEBUG(D_VFSTRACE, "VFS Op:inode=%lu/%u(%p) off "LPU64"\n",
+               inode->i_ino, inode->i_generation, inode, offset);
 
         mdc_pack_fid(&mdc_fid, inode->i_ino, inode->i_generation, S_IFDIR);
 
-        offset = page->index << PAGE_SHIFT;
         rc = mdc_readpage(ll_i2sbi(inode)->ll_mdc_exp, &mdc_fid,
                           offset, page, &request);
         if (!rc) {